Output 81d384b9baa314764688df29ce37764ea1550942b5246e96935421f220b61f02:33

value
188902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da31ec442d2f6abda0bab2aaaf1902f85bfd73c OP_EQUAL
address
3LSKrf7aTU8rAUEwAHHAsVWfXi4HdQ7CUT
transaction
81d384b9baa314764688df29ce37764ea1550942b5246e96935421f220b61f02
confirmations
220022
spent
true